Developments in Robotics
One major development in oral surgery is making use of robot modern technology, which permits precise and efficient operations. With the help of robotic systems, dental surgeons have the capacity to execute complicated surgical treatments with boosted precision, reducing the danger of human mistake.
These robotic systems are geared up with advanced imaging innovation and precise tools that enable specialists to navigate via intricate anatomical frameworks easily. By using robotic innovation, specialists can attain greater surgical accuracy, resulting in enhanced individual results and faster recovery times.
Additionally, using robotics in oral surgery allows for minimally intrusive procedures, minimizing the trauma to bordering cells and promoting faster recovery.

Minimally Intrusive Strategies
To even more progress the area of dental surgery, accept the capacity of minimally intrusive methods that can considerably profit both doctors and individuals alike.
Minimally invasive methods are changing the field by lowering surgical injury, minimizing post-operative discomfort, and speeding up the recuperation procedure. These techniques involve utilizing smaller sized cuts and specialized tools to execute treatments with accuracy and effectiveness.
By making use of sophisticated imaging innovation, such as cone light beam computed tomography (CBCT), specialists can precisely intend and perform surgeries with very little invasiveness.
Additionally, the use of lasers in dental surgery permits precise cells cutting and coagulation, leading to lessened bleeding and reduced recovery time.
With minimally invasive techniques, individuals can experience quicker healing, reduced scarring, and boosted end results, making it an important facet of the future of dental surgery.
